CTSP Episode 137 - Coatings Under Insulation & Evolution of the Standard Practices

Paul Atzemis and Jack Walker discuss the evolution of coatings under insulation. They explore the early practices and what is commonly performed today.

CTSP Episode 136 - Thick-film & Thin-Film Coating Systems

Jack Walker and Paul Atzemis discuss the factors in choosing a thick-film coating system versus choosing a thin-film coating system. Abrasion, flexibility, substrates, and application equipment are all discussed.

CTSP Episode 135 - Cost of Coatings (Pt. 5) - Per Gallon Price vs. Applied Cost

The one about math

Jack Walker and Paul Atzemis continue their discussion on cost considerations for coatings projects. They discuss the differences between applied cost and price per gallon.

CTSP Episode 134 - Cost of Coatings (Pt. 4) - Immersion Grade Linings

The one about not being over

Jack Walker and Paul Atzemis continue their exploration in the costs of coatings projects. This week the duo explores immersion grade linings and the factors that affect their value. They explore everything from coal tar epoxies to 100% solids polyurethane linings.

CTSP Episode 113 - SFRM Part 2

The one about specific materials

Jack Walker and Paul Atzemis have Sean Younger in the studio for Part 2 of the discussion of Carboline's SFRM materials, Southwest Type 5 and Type 7 lines. They expand on the difference between gypsum and Portland cement-based materials and when and where to use them. Original airdate 3/26/18.
